Transaction eabbe21f2412109dc7c3cc16c5cadca8c55d50e2c13c61328da787513bcea781
1 Input
1 Output
-
eabbe21f2412109dc7c3cc16c5cadca8c55d50e2c13c61328da787513bcea781:0
- value
- 822586
- script pubkey
- OP_0 OP_PUSHBYTES_20 53be95726fd5f3745e6b3d9d3014717b8682d8ea
- address
- bc1q2wlf2un06hehghnt8kwnq9r30wrg9k82z7qhhv